Here is an excerpt from the owner:
"I bought this 1979 boat when it was 18 months old in 1981 and the first year kept it at Toledo Beach Marina in southern Michigan and sailed Lake Erie. Between 1981 and 1989 I sailed Lake Erie, Lake Huron, and the Canadian North channel. In April 1989, I began a circumnavigation via the Panama Canal and the Suez Canal touching a couple dozen countries, arriving back in Michigan in July 1991. Since then I've cruised out of Cheboygan Michigan in Lake Huron.
I've added solar panels in 1984 or so, and doubled up the upper shrouds and added an additional forestay. I spent $25,000 I think in 2016 replacing all the electronics including the auto pilot, radar, depth sounder, entertainment center, and VHF radio. And added the latest Garmin chart plotter. I added a deck washer pump recently and a propane leak detector system. When necessary, I would replace sails and all the canvas work. Over the course of 43 years I have upgraded replaced and maintained everything on the boat."

The designer, Henry Scheel, was also the builder of the original molds for this yacht at his company in Maine in the early 1970’s. (Sheel had collaborated with Charles Morgan on a number of the earlier Morgan’s.)
The molds later came into the possession of Morgan Yachts, where they were used for a number of years with various modifications to build a number of models similar to the one shown here.

The Deck: She features a low center cockpit for ultimate visibility; lots of hatches: fourteen opening ports; and two large lazarettes aft. There is also a large emergency exit that can serve as a private entrance to the owner's stateroom.
Interior: A Teak and Holly plydeck sole runs throughout. Three private staterooms are standard. Each of the two large heads are complete with showers, with a tub included in the master stateroom head. The galley is a cook's delight. U-Shaped for comfort and convenience under way, the galley abounds with counter and storage space. Twin deep stainless steel sinks and a huge 19 cu. ft. top load ice box with two lids lead a long list of highlights. The open main salon is designed for comfortable entertaining, doubling as a dinette or extra berths as needed. The navigation station will please the most discriminating, with plenty of space to house the equipment necessary to take your yacht anywhere in the world. At the heart of this yacht is a dual access engine room, housing a powerful Perkins diesel while leaving plenty of room for accessories including an optional 7.5 KW generator.
Systems: All the plumbing is polybutylene tubing and rigid PVC. All the wiring is color coded to the recommended American Boat and Yacht Council standards and wired through a custom 115V AC, 12V DC modular electrical panel which contains hydraulic/magnetic breakers. The large fuel and water tanks make long extended passages a cinch. The easily adjusted main sheet traveler and three-speed Lewmar sheet winches make sail handling a joy. The optional Hyde rod roller furling system makes sail handling even easier, especially for short-handed crews.
Construction: The deck and hull are both hand laminated solid fiberglass with added sandwiched plywood coring in the deck. The keel houses internal cast lead ballast which is grouted around and fully glassed-over for the extra protection afforded by this double bottom effect. All cabinetry and bulkheads are double bonded to the hull sides for their entire length with a heavy 20-oz. woven roving. To create a unitized construction system for additional strength and stiffness all cabinetry components are also bonded to each other. In addition, all exposed metals below the waterline are bronze to resist electrolysis.
